Morales, TX D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is an in-depth medical evaluation required for all commercial motor vehicle (CMV) operators by the Department of Transportation (DOT). This assessment guarantees that professional drivers are fit physically, mentally, and emotionally to handle large vehicles on public highways safely. Certified medical examiners (CMEs) listed on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ners (NRCME) conduct the DOT physical. Successfully passing the evaluation enables drivers to acquire a DOT medical certificate, also known as a DOT medical card, necessary to uphold a valid CDL license as per FMCSA regulations.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review of health history and medication check
  • Vision test (corrective lenses acceptable; must meet minimum vision standards)
  • Hearing check (by forced whisper or audio test)
  • Examination of blood pressure and pulse
  • Comprehensive physical check-up (general systems review)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ose levels)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must have a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Have a commercial driver's license (CDL)- class A,B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Drive a vehicle over 10,001 lbs. GVWR in interstate commerce
  • Transport more than 8 passengers (for hire) or more than 15 passengers (not for hire)
  • Transport hazardous materials that require placarding under DOT regulations
  • Work for employers regulated by DOT agencies such as F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A or USCG where DOT medical qualification is required

What to bring with you to a DOT Physical?

  • Government-issued photo ID
  • Glasses/contacts & prescription
  • List of medications & dosages
  • CPAP usage data (if applicable)
  • Specialist clearances (cardiology, sleep apnea, diabetes, etc.)
  • Recent A1C/blood pressure logs if monitored

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Vision below 20/40 in each eye (even with correction), inability to differentiate traffic signal colors, or an inability to hear a forced whisper at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Unmanaged hypertension (≥180/110 mmHg), recent heart attack or stroke, uncontrolled angina, or an implanted defibrillator without approval.
  • Diabetes: Unmanaged diabetes with frequent hypoglycemic episodes or complications that affect safe dri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Issues: Untreated obstructive sleep apnea leading to daytime sleepiness, or severe respiratory disease affecting oxygenation.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y/seizure disorders (without exemption), conditions causing sudden consciousness loss, dizziness, or uncontrolled tremors.
  • Substance Abuse: Current usage of illegal drugs, alcohol dependence, or misuse of prescription drugs that impair driving.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Disorders: Severe unmanaged mental illness or cognitive dysfunction affecting judgment and response time.

Issues might only temporarily disqualify you until clearance or documentation is provided (e.g., controlled blood pressure, managed diabetes). Others, like untreated seizure disorders or implanted defibrillators, are usually permanently disqualifying under FMCSA rules.
